Fans of Dan Brown's bestselling novel The Da Vinci Code and the blockbuster movie starring Tom Hanks will enjoy this tour of the London locations mentioned in the story.

Temple Church - Home of the Knights Templar

After meeting your guide outside Temple station you'll walk down the street where Robert Langdon and Sophie Neveu escaped from Remy, and then head for the ancient home of the Knights Templar.

The 900-year-old Temple Church was built just sixty years after the Crusaders first captured Jerusalem, and still contains the stone effigies of eight medieval knights.

Your guide will delve into the history of the Knights, shedding some light on how they came to power in the Holy Land, and giving you a glimpse into the symbolism that features so heavily throughout Dan Brown's novel.

A short walk to Trafalgar Square will take you to the National Gallery, where you'll see one of Leonardo Da Vinci's most famous paintings - The Virgin of the Rocks.

You'll then walk past the Royal Courts of Justice and Temple Bar and head down Whitehall, past the sentries outside Horse Guards, until you reach Big Ben and the Houses of Parliament.

Along the way your friendly guide will be sharing some interesting stills from the film and quotes from the book, unlocking some of the central mysteries of the complicated plot.

The tour will come to an end with another talk outside Westminster Abbey.
